British humor often mixes dry one‑liners with out‑of‑the‑blue moments. Shows like Fleabag and The Office proved that awkward silences can be just as funny as big punchlines. The magic comes from using real‑life situations and turning them on their head. That’s why a simple scene about a morning commute can turn into a cultural reference you’ll quote for months.
Another key is the diversity of styles. From the slapstick of Mr. Bean to the political satire of Veep (yes, that’s a US‑made show, but it leans on British sensibility), there’s something for every taste. The UK’s strong theatre tradition also feeds into TV comedy, giving writers a solid foundation in timing and character work.

Don’t forget the podcast scene. Shows like My Dad Wrote a Porno and The Bugle keep the humor rolling when you’re on the go. Subscribing to a few daily comedy podcasts can turn a boring commute into a mini‑stand‑up session.
Finally, keep an eye on award ceremonies. The British Comedy Awards and the BAFTAs often spotlight emerging talent. Winners from these events usually land new series within months, so they’re a good predictor of what’s about to trend.
